数控铝件金刚石怎么编程

时间:2025-03-05 01:05:54 明星趣事

数控铝件金刚石的编程可以通过以下几种软件和方法实现:

CAD/CAM软件

CAD软件:用于设计和建模产品,如AutoCAD、SolidWorks等,可以创建铝件的三维模型。

CAM软件:将设计转化为机床能够识别和执行的工艺路径,如Mastercam、GibbsCAM等,可以生成刀具路径、切割深度和刀具轨迹。

G代码

G代码是一种通用的数控机床编程语言,包含机床的运动指令、刀具的切削参数和工件的几何信息。使用G代码编程需要一定的编程知识和经验,但提供了更大的灵活性和自定义能力。

CAM插件

一些金刚石车床供应商提供特定的CAM插件,可以与CAD软件集成,生成优化的刀具路径和切削策略。这些插件通常具有预设的参数和优化算法,可以帮助用户快速生成高效的程序。

自定义软件

一些用户可能选择开发自己的金刚石车床编程软件,以满足特定的需求和要求。这种自定义软件可以根据用户的工艺要求和机床配置进行定制,但需要专业的软件开发知识和技能。

手动编程

对于简单的加工任务,可以手动编写数控程序,包括指定加工路径、刀具选择、切削速度、进给速度等参数。这种方法适用于对加工过程有深入了解的用户。

编程步骤概述:

确定加工需求

根据产品图纸,确定需要进行的加工操作(如切割、铣削、钻孔等),了解产品的尺寸、形状和所需加工工序。

选择编程语言

根据机床的控制系统和加工要求,选择合适的编程语言(如G代码或M代码)。

编写数控程序

使用选择的编程语言,编写数控程序,逐个指定加工操作的加工路径、刀具选择、切削速度、进给速度等参数。

调试和验证程序

在实际的数控机床上加载并运行编写好的数控程序,通过模拟运行或实际加工来验证程序的正确性和加工效果,并根据需要进行调整和修改。

保存和管理程序

将验证通过的数控程序保存并进行管理,以备将来重复使用或进行进一步的修改和优化。

建议:

对于复杂的铝件加工任务,建议使用CAD/CAM软件来提高编程效率和精度。

对于简单的加工任务,可以考虑手动编程或使用G代码进行编程。

无论使用哪种编程方法,都应确保对加工过程有充分的了解,并在实际加工前进行充分的调试和验证。